1) Bridging the Sim to Real Divide

Robotics and AI models can look brilliant in simulation, then wobble in the wild. Weather, edge cases, messy facilities, and human behavior do not read the script. The fix is a disciplined path from lab to live.

  • Invest in domain randomization and physics-aware simulation, then validate with small but rich real-world datasets.
  • Run shadow mode in production. Let models observe and predict without controlling outcomes, compare to human ground truth, and only promote when stable.
  • Instrument recovery and interruption metrics. Track mean time to intervention, auto-recovery rate, and task success under perturbation.
  • Adopt staged rollouts. Start with friendly sites and expand to high-variance environments once drift controls are proven.

Outcome: fewer surprises during deployment, faster iteration, and confidence that your AI can survive Mondays in the real world.

2) Transparent, Auditable AI in Regulated Industries

In spaces watched by FINRA and the SEC, explainability is not a nice-to-have. Advisors, compliance teams, and auditors need to know what the model did, why it did it, and where the data came from. Trust is earned with traceability.

  • Adopt model cards and decision logs. Capture inputs, features, rationale, variants tested, and outcomes for every decision that matters.
  • Build data lineage that spans ingestion to inference. Prove data provenance, retention policy, and consent state at any point in time.
  • Use reason codes and human review points. Make explanations consumable by non-technical stakeholders and require approval for sensitive actions.
  • Codify policy as code. Translate regulatory rules into machine-readable checks that block non-compliant inferences pre-decision.

Outcome: stakeholder trust, smoother audits, faster advisor adoption, and fewer compliance headaches.

3) Mastering Multi-System Data Governance

Your AI is only as good as the data diet you feed it. Integrating PIM, DAM, CRM, and SIEM, then keeping data accurate, normalized, and retained correctly, is the quiet hero of AI performance.

  • Stand up a unified metadata catalog. Tag business definitions, owners, and quality SLAs so teams speak the same language.
  • Publish data contracts. Define schemas, freshness, and validation rules at the boundary of every system-to-system handshake.
  • Automate normalization and deduplication. Use reference data services to align IDs and attributes across sources.
  • Close the loop with observability. Monitor drift, null explosions, and schema breaks, then route alerts to the owning teams.
  • Treat retention as a product. Encode legal hold, regional residency, and deletion workflows that your auditors can verify.

Outcome: cleaner features, sharper analytics, more accurate threat detection, and fewer 2 a.m. incidents from brittle pipelines.

4) Fixing the AI Expertise and Community Deficit

Most orgs do not lack ideas. They lack pattern libraries, peer networks, and a bench of practitioners who have seen the movie before. Build the community, then the roadmap writes itself.

  • Create an internal AI guild. Weekly show-and-tell, architecture reviews, and a shared repo of templates and runbooks.
  • Stand up a center of enablement. Provide platform tooling, security guardrails, and cost management that product teams can self-serve.
  • Launch lighthouse projects with explicit learning goals. Document what worked and what failed, then templatize the win.
  • Plug into external communities. Partner with universities, vendors, and open source forums to widen your idea flow.

Outcome: faster scoping, better prioritization, and less dependency on unicorn hires.

Common Pitfalls to Avoid

  • Overfitting to simulation. If the real world is an afterthought, you will pay for it in production.
  • Compliance theater. Fancy dashboards without decision logs and lineage will not satisfy auditors.
  • Big bang integration. Merging every system at once creates a traffic jam. Start with the highest-value interfaces and expand.
  • Hero culture. One brilliant data scientist cannot scale an AI program. Invest in documentation, governance, and communities.
